What is a Cylinder Lock?
A cylinder lock is a typically used locking mechanism found in residential and commercial spaces. These locks are understood for their round shape and are normally set up within a door. The locking mechanism itself is contained within the cylinder, which can be quickly removed and changed, making it a preferred among locksmith professionals and DIY lovers alike.

Replacing a cylinder lock can be broken down into numerous straightforward steps. Below is a detailed guide to assist at the same time:
Tools RequiredScrewdriver (Phillips or flat-head depending on your lock)New cylinder lockTape measurePen and paper (for notes if required)Step-by-Step Instructions
Eliminate the Old Lock
Find the screws securing the lock casing on the door's edge. Use the screwdriver to remove these screws.Once unscrewed, pull the cylinder out from the modern door locks.
Procedure the Existing Cylinder
Taking measurements is vital. Step the cylinder length from the back of the cylinder to the front (the exposed portion).If your knob lock replacement is a split cylinder, procedure both areas.
Purchase a Replacement Lock
Using the measurements, select a replacement cylinder lock that matches the dimensions.Think about acquiring a lock with enhanced security functions.
Insert the New Cylinder
Line up the new cylinder with the hole in the exterior door locks replacement and slide it in. Make sure the cam (the turning mechanism) aligns correctly with the locking mechanism.Secure it in place by reattaching the screws removed in the primary step.
Check the New Lock
Insert the new secret and test the lock to ensure it operates efficiently. If the lock doesn't turn quickly, remove it and examine alignment again.
Reassemble Any Additional Components

If you're struggling to eliminate the old lock, ensure you have removed all screws. Sometimes a bit of wiggling or using a mild pull can help.
Can I change a lock without calling a locksmith professional?
Yes, changing a locks cylinder is a workable task for many DIY enthusiasts, as long as you follow the guidelines supplied.
How do I choose the best cylinder lock?
Select a lock that matches the size requirements of your old lock and provides security functions that line up with your needs.
Is it safe to set up a cylinder lock myself?
As long as you follow the appropriate treatment and make sure whatever is fitted appropriately, installing a lock yourself is safe. However, if you're uncertain, a professional locksmith is constantly a choice.
Do I need special tools to replace a cylinder lock?
A lot of cylinder locks can be replaced using typical family tools like screwdrivers. Special tools are not usually needed.
